Biking in Yosemite

The North-East entrance to Yosemite is the Tioga Pass. Through it, you enter Tuolumne Meadows and eventually Yosemite Valley. The pass is at 10,000' and tends to close earlier and open late, due to snow. It is supposed to open next week and it is 'mostly' plowed. Before it opens, we decided to drive to the gate and bike in. Yosemite, for anyone who has ever been there, is usually a zoo unless you go far back country. Lots of cars and tourists. Being in Tuolumne before it opens was magical. Very beautiful and no one was there. You're not even allowed to bring bikes into Yosemite, but since it was a holiday before it opens, there were no rangers there to enforce it. We went in about 12 miles losing 1700' of elevation. Of course, we had to climb back up that 1700' in 12 miles on the way back.

I still can't believe I live here, where I have the opportunity to do these types of things. The rivers were raging and the snow was still everywhere. Its one thing to go to the gym and get on the stationary bike, its another to ride in one of the most beautiful places on earth.

From Tioga Pass back to the 395 is 8 or 9 miles of downhill road (Hwy 120). We decided it would be fun to bike, so we took turns. Derek biked down as I drove and then halfway down we switched. The computer on my bike said I got up to 51 mph. Very fun.
